**Q: Why does LiftSim's dispatch queue use a custom heap instead of the standard library?**

The stdlib heap reorders equal-priority hall calls, which breaks determinism in replay tests. Our heap is insertion-stable. Don't "simplify" it during review — the replay suite will fail silently on some seeds. See `docs/determinism.md` for the full rationale. Questions about the heap invariants go to the sim-core maintainer.

escalation mailbox, hahog-yahop: wenox.ralix.ralax@qirvandata.local

Subject: FD leak hunt — reassignment

Quick note: the leaked-file-descriptor investigation in the Quillgate ingest service is changing hands. Please route related review requests accordingly and flag any suspicious socket handling you spot during normal reviews. The lsof snapshots and repro script are in the shared runbook. Effective immediately, the hunt is owned by the person named below.

named custodian: Oliath Ralax

Onboarding note for the Ledgerpane admin table: bulk edits are applied through the batcher service, not directly against the database. Select rows, choose an action, and the batcher stages changes in a pending set you can review before commit. Edits over 500 rows require a second approver — this is enforced server-side, so don't try to chunk around it. To run the batcher locally you need the staging write credential, which goes in your .env as the next line.

secret setting of bahip-kagag: RELAY_SECRET3=c83

Action item: The Relayn deploy-status bot silently dropped updates when the pipeline API paginated results, so responders believed a rollback had completed when it had not. We will add pagination handling, a staleness banner, and an integration test. Until merged, verify deploy state directly in the pipeline console, documented at the page below.

runbook for kahop-kajop: https://rundeck.ordinio.test/display/secrets/pipeline/issue/pages/repo/browse/e5732776e07d1285107e5aeb